Friday, July 29, 2011

Palace on the Wheels

Palace on Wheels, is a luxury train in India providing unmatched quality and royal tour to travelers to many cultural destinations in India.

Source: http://www.articlesfactory.com/articles/travel/palace-on-the-wheels.html

travel tips for japan travel tips for costa rica travel ideas travel ideas for kids travel ideas for couples travel ideas for march

No comments:

Post a Comment